Output b3306aca8b063215065d809387eda8ffcbba345ced847b0dac20c376efdd089a:0

value
669042
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85344874ebbc74f1094c10965e6a5862fd97837d OP_EQUAL
address
3DqLRkE7BxzejNtwALryDTZNS38QgHZiB5
transaction
b3306aca8b063215065d809387eda8ffcbba345ced847b0dac20c376efdd089a
spent
true